Genuine Speedster or Conversion? by hipomino in Porsche

[–]Misterhan1 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Yup. Gunther Werks is a tuner and the cars retain their Porsche VINs like Singers. Ruf is the only manufacturer amongst Porsche tuners that come with their own W09 VINs. However, Ruf conversions retain their WP0 Porsche VINs.
